                                  INTRODUCTION

         This Amendment No.1 to Schedule 13 D ("Amendment No. 1") is intended
to amend and supplement certain information set forth in the Schedule 13D filed
on February 7, 1997 (the "Initial Filing") by HealthPlan Services Corporation,
a Delaware corporation.


ITEM 1.  SECURITY AND ISSUER

         The title of the class of equity securities to which this Amendment
No. 1 relates is the common stock, par value $.001 per share (the "Common
Stock"), of Caredata.com,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the "Company"). The
address of the Company's principal executive office is Two Piedmont Center,
Suite 400, Atlanta, Georgia 30305.

ITEM 3.  SOURCE AND AMOUNT OF FUNDS OR OTHER CONSIDERATION

         This Amendment No. 1 relates to the sale by HPS of 100,000 shares of
Common Stock on March 2, 1998 and of 60,000 shares of Common Stock on March 25,
1998. Each of these dispositions was effected through brokerage transactions.
As a result, the source of funds used by the various purchasers is not known to
HPS. Please see Item 5 below for further information on the transactions.

ITEM 4.  PURPOSE OF TRANSACTION

         The purpose of the sale of the 160,000 shares of Common Stock in the
March 2, 1998 and March 25, 1998 transactions was to liquidate some of HPS's
investment in Caredata.com, Inc.

ITEM 5.  INTEREST IN SECURITIES OF THE ISSUER

         (a) 109,732 shares of Common Stock, representing approximately 1.34%
of the outstanding Common Stock.

         (b) HPS holds all of the shares set out in (a) above with sole
dispositive power.

         (c) On March 2, 1998, HPS sold 100,000 shares of the Common Stock in a
brokerage transaction for $19.25 per share. At the time of such disposition,
and after giving effect thereto, HPS held 380,443 shares of Common Stock
(approximately 8.47% of the outstanding Common Stock). On March 25, 1998 HPS
sold 60,0000 shares of the Common Stock in a brokerage transaction for $22.29
per share. At the time of such disposition, and after giving effect thereto,
HPS held 320,443, shares of Common Stock (approximately 7.13% of the
outstanding Common Stock). Subsequent dispositions through June 1998 by HPS
reduced the holdings of HPS to 109,732 shares of Common Stock, which
dispositions are reported in Amendment No. 2 to Schedule 13D (filed immediately
following this Amendment No. 1).

         (d) No other person has the right to receive the proceeds from the
sale being reported herein.

         (e) HPS ceased to be the beneficial owner of more than five percent of
the Shares of the Company on June 11, 1998.
